Introduction to Gambling Regulations
The world of gambling is vast and complex, governed by a myriad of legal regulations that vary from one jurisdiction to another. These regulations are designed to protect players, ensure fair play, and manage the economic impact of gambling activities. Understanding the legal framework surrounding gambling is essential for both operators and players to navigate this dynamic industry. Different countries have different approaches to gambling laws, leading to a patchwork of regulations that can be challenging to comprehend. Some nations have strict prohibitions on gambling, while others have embraced it as a significant source of revenue. This dichotomy creates a fascinating landscape for gambling enthusiasts and operators alike, necessitating a clear understanding of the legalities involved.
Types of Gambling Regulations
Gambling regulations can generally be categorized into three main types: licensing, operational, and consumer protection laws. Licensing laws dictate who can operate gambling establishments or online platforms. These laws often require thorough background checks and financial disclosures to ensure that only reputable entities can engage in gambling operations.
Operational regulations focus on how gambling activities are conducted. This includes guidelines on how games must be played, the payout percentages that must be maintained, and the methods of advertising. Consumer protection laws, on the other hand, are designed to safeguard players from fraud and ensure responsible gambling practices. The Importance of Compliance
Compliance with gambling regulations is crucial for operators. Failing to adhere to legal standards can result in hefty fines, license revocation, and damage to reputation. It is not just a legal obligation but also a moral one, as operators have a duty to create a fair and transparent gaming experience for their players.
Moreover, compliance fosters trust among players. When users know that an online gambling platform is fully licensed and adheres to stringent regulations, they are more likely to engage with it confidently. This trust is vital in a highly competitive market where players have numerous options at their disposal.
Global Trends in Gambling Legislation
In recent years, there has been a notable trend towards the liberalization of gambling laws in various regions. Countries that once had strict prohibitions are beginning to recognize the economic benefits of regulated gambling. This shift often leads to the establishment of legal frameworks that promote responsible gambling while harnessing tax revenues from the industry.
Additionally, the rise of online gambling has prompted governments to adapt their regulations to better address the unique challenges it presents. These adaptations often include enhanced consumer protection measures and stricter oversight of online operators. Understanding these global trends is essential for anyone looking to engage in gambling activities or operate within this space.
